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This essential explains what distinguishes light sheet microscopy from ordinary light microscopy. The author briefly examines the history of such principles, focusing on the technical concepts. Finally, current manifestations are presented without descending into the depths of the art of engineering. The unusual feature of light-sheet microscopy is not only that observation and illumination take place at a right angle, but also that this type of microscopy gains in particular from the fact that the type of illumination only passes through a very small part of the specimen. The appropriate selection of optical elements ensures that the observed image no longer contains any blurred parts. Book excerpt: Light sheet fluorescence microscopy (LSFM) is used in many biological research experiments that require fast three-dimensional (3D) imaging up to a few volumes per second. Wavefront coding (WFC) microscopy provides LSFM with 3D real-time imaging capabilities introducing a controlled aberration that extends the depth of field (DOF) of the microscope objective. Resulting images, however, are blurred and need to be processed to recover the original sharpness in a CPU-intensive deconvolution which makes real-time visualization unattainable. We present computational tools based on GPU parallel computing to achieve real-time deconvolution and visualization of the images obtained with WFC light-sheet microscopy.

Book excerpt: This book presents a comprehensive and coherent summary of techniques for enhancing the resolution and image contrast provided by far-field optical microscopes. It takes a critical look at the body of knowledge that comprises optical microscopy, compares and contrasts the various instruments, provides a clear discussion of the physical principles that underpin these techniques, and describes advances in science and medicine for which superresolution microscopes are required and are making major contributions. The text fills significant gaps that exist in other works on superresolution imaging, firstly by placing a new emphasis on the specimen, a critical component of the microscope setup, giving equal importance to the enhancement of both resolution and contrast. Secondly, it covers several topics not typically discussed in depth, such as Bessel and Airy beams, the physics of the spiral phase plate, vortex beams and singular optics, photoactivated localization microscopy (PALM), stochastic optical reconstruction microscopy (STORM), structured illumination microscopy (SIM), and light-sheet fluorescence microscopy (LSFM). Several variants of these techniques are critically discussed. Noise, optical aberrations, specimen damage, and artifacts in microscopy are also covered. The importance of validation of superresolution images with electron microscopy is stressed.
